Made In Chelsea star Frankie Gaff gives birth to baby boy

The reality star, 27, shared the happy news on Instagram on Wednesday night, posting photos of her newborn son Theodore.

Frankie told her followers she and venture capitalist boyfriend Jamie Dickerson welcomed their baby boy on November 29.

Frankie shared a series of photos with the caption ‘Baby Theodore 29.11.21’, showing the newborn nestled on her chest after the birth.

Another shot saw baby Theodore wrapped up warm in a cosy jacket, sleeping soundly in a moses basket.

Frankie’s boyfriend Jamie featured in another sweet snap, cuddling his son as they both snoozed at home.

The star took to Instagram in July to announce she was expecting with her venture capitalist boyfriend.

Frankie first appeared on Made In Chelsea in its 11th season – and went on to star in the show until series 15, as well as the summer seasons in America, Ibiza and the South of France in between.

Her main story-line featured her rocky relationship with Jamie Laing, which came to an end at the end of 2017.

After her break up with Jamie, she attempted to get back into the dating game with current stars James Taylor and Harry Baron, but this went nowhere.

Last year, a source told The Sun that she was blissfully happy with her new businessman beau.

‘Frankie is smitten. She feels really comfortable with this Jamie and trusts him. He’s really mature and together, but they have a lot of fun too,’ the insider said.

Her last few appearances on MIC saw her lock horns with Olivia Bentley, who still stars in the reality show.

Rumours had rumbled about her quitting in 2018, before series 15 began airing.

When her final episode was shown, she confirmed the news by taking to Twitter and posting: ‘Ciao Ciao. Onto the next adventure!’

Her last scene saw her tell friend Sophie ‘Habbs’ Habboo that she needed time away from the drama and was last seen leaving Mimi Bouchard’s pyjama party.

Habbs has since gone on to form a romance with Jamie, and the pair have been together since. The state of Habbs and Frankie’s friendship is unclear.

Prior to her exit, it seemed that Frankie was losing her patience with the show anyway, tweeting during one episode: ‘Wow how boring are we, sitting in various cafes over London talking about boring boy bulls**t, as if that’s all there is to us!’
